Apple’s Repair Policy

If you’re looking to have your Apple Watch screen replaced, it’s essential to understand Apple’s repair policy. Apple offers a one-year limited warranty on all Apple Watch models, which covers manufacturing defects and other issues. However, accidental damage is not covered under this warranty, so if you’ve damaged your screen, you’ll need to pay for the replacement or repair out of pocket. That being said, Apple does offer AppleCare+, an extended warranty program that covers accidental damage, including screen damage, for up to two years.

Costs and Pricing

The cost of replacing an Apple Watch screen can vary depending on the model and the extent of the damage. Apple’s repair prices start at around $299 for a Series 1 or Series 2 Apple Watch, while more recent models like the Series 5 or Series 6 can cost upwards of $399 to repair. If you have AppleCare+, you may be able to get your screen replaced for a lower fee, typically around $29. Third-party repair shops may offer cheaper prices, but be sure to check the quality of their work before committing to their services.

Apple Watch ModelApple’s Repair PriceAppleCare+ Repair Price
Series 1 or Series 2$299$29
Series 3 or Series 4$349$29
Series 5 or Series 6$399$29

Note: Prices may vary depending on the location and availability of repair services. It’s always best to check with Apple or an authorized service provider for the most up-to-date pricing information.
